Technical Details for Developers
How the Cache-Proof Technology Works:
- Static Placeholder: The plugin injects minimal HTML placeholders that can be safely cached
- Client-Side Initialization: JavaScript detects these placeholders after page load
- REST API Call: Makes a single, lightweight API call to fetch active scenarios and server time
- Local Computation: All countdown calculations happen in the browser
- Real-Time Updates: JavaScript updates the countdown every second locally
This architecture ensures:
– Pages remain fully cacheable
– No PHP execution on cached pages
– Accurate countdowns regardless of cache age
– Minimal server load (one API call per page load)
– Compatible with all caching layers (plugin, server, CDN)
